Oddly sized burrito locks down school

This morning a concerned citizen of Clovis, New Mexico called authorities a student carrying a suspicious item into the Junior High School.

The school was locked-down and two hours later, the suspicious item was identified as a 30-inch burrito wrapped inside tin foil and a white T-shirt. It was part of an extra credit project to create advertising for a restaurant specializing in oddly sized burritos.

When the police saw the burrito, they laughed. Apparently, the burrito was wrapped in a T-shirt to keep it warm.
